## Tuning

The PointsKeeper ledger batches accrual events before committing them to the Marloft store. If you're adjusting throughput for the Bryce account migration, please change only the values below and run the reconciliation suite afterward — drift between batch size and flush interval causes double-counting. The current tuning constants are as follows.

tuning constants:
WEIGHTS = {
    "wendor": 631,
    "norir": 625,
    "julael": 998,
}

### Changelog — Slimcrate 0.9.3

Rotated the image signing key as part of the quarterly refresh (welcome aboard, by the way — this happens every quarter, don't panic). No changes to the slimming pipeline itself; base layers still get pruned as before. Update your local trust store with the new key shown below.

release key, fajef-kajeg: bky19_LdLu6Ne6FLi8he2c24d

**Vendor note: Inkmill markdown pipeline**

Rendering for Parchway docs is outsourced to Inkmill under an annual contract, renewing each March. They handle sanitization and PDF export; we own the upload queue. SLA: 4-hour response on rendering failures. Escalate only after two failed retries. Their support desk is reachable at the address below.

billing contact of hahaf-baguf = zorael.tammir.jorius@sivrelhq.internal

## Who to ping about GiftNote

Welcome aboard! GiftNote is our donation-receipt mailer for the Larchfield Fund. Template tweaks go to the comms folks; delivery failures and bounce weirdness go to the platform crew. Don't push template changes on Fridays — receipts batch over the weekend. For anything GiftNote-related, start with the address below.

billing contact of kaweg-tajeg = drudor.lamion.oliath@torvalabs.test

# Approvals: Sharding the Profile Store

Welcome aboard! Quick context: we're splitting the Hollowpine user-profile store into 16 shards keyed by account hash. Any PR touching the shard router or the migration scripts needs a formal approval — no exceptions, even for "tiny" fixes. Dry-run the rebalance locally first. The one person who can grant that approval is listed below.

approver of bagaf-hahif = Casok Jorael Quenys Rusdor